Overview Rabecott 20mg Tablet
Gastro-acid reducer Acidex 20mg tablets lessen stomach acid production. Indicated for acid-related gastrointestinal disorders like acid reflux, peptic ulcers, and Zollinger-Ellison syndrome, it alleviates symptoms and aids healing. Acidex 20mg should be ingested an hour pre-meal, ideally mornings. Dosage is condition- and response-dependent; maintain consistent daily timing as directed. Continue treatment as prescribed, even with rapid symptom resolution. Dietary modifications, such as smaller, more frequent meals and avoidance of caffeine, spicy, and fatty foods, may enhance symptom management. Common, typically mild, side effects include nausea, vomiting, headache, dizziness, gas, diarrhea, and stomach ache. Report persistent or bothersome effects to your physician. Prolonged use (over a year), particularly at higher doses, may elevate bone fracture risk. Discuss bone loss prevention strategies, such as calcium and vitamin D supplementation, with your doctor. Hypomagnesemia (low magnesium) has been observed in some patients after three or more months of use; this can manifest as fatigue, confusion, dizziness, muscle spasms, or irregular heartbeat. Your doctor may monitor your magnesium levels. Acidex 20mg is contraindicated for individuals with severe hepatic impairment, those on HIV medications, those with prior allergic reactions to similar drugs, or those with pre-existing osteoporosis. Pregnant or lactating women should consult their physician before use. Alcohol should be avoided due to its acid-stimulating effects. Refrain from operating machinery if dizziness or drowsiness occurs.

How Rabecott 20mg Tablet works:
Acidity relief is provided by the proton pump inhibitor (PPI) Rabecott 20mg Tablet. This medication lessens stomach acid production, thereby easing heartburn and acid indigestion.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holCAUTION
Exercise caution when drinking alcohol while taking Rabecott 20mg tablets. Seek medical advice before combining them.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Using Rabecott 20mg tablets during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scarce, animal studies indicate potential harm to the unborn child. A physician will assess the advantages against possible dangers before prescribing. Seek medical advice.
Breast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Use of Rabecott 20mg tablets while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Available human data indicates potential transfer of the medication into breast milk, posing a possible risk to the infant.
DrivingUNSAFE
Taking a 20mg Rabecott tablet might reduce alertness, impair vision, and cause drowsiness or dizziness. Driving should be avoided if these effects are experienced.
Kid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
For individuals with kidney impairment, Rabecott 20mg tablets are considered safe. No alteration to the prescribed dosage of Rabecott 20mg tablets is necessary.
LiverS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Patients with liver disease can safely use Rabecott 20mg tablets without requiring any dosage modification.
What if you forget to take Rabecott 20mg Tablet :
Should you forget a Rabecott 20mg Tablet dose, administer it at your earliest convenience.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
